Set your phone in fastboot mode (like you were unlocking the boot loader), put the file in the folder you named root to unlock your bootloader, run fastboot flash recovery LTErecovery_cwr.img (fastboot-windows, -mac, or -linux system depending) (also at this point you need the device connected to the PC and you are running this command in a command prompt, just to be thorough), and then I just keyed up on the volume until it said recovery and hit power.
